JOB OVERVIEW

Life In…Magazines is a community-focused publishing business producing three much-loved magazines in the Borough of Bromley. We recently developed a mobile app (using ---------- ) which is already live for iOS. We now need an experienced professional to guide us through the process of getting the app approved and available on Google Play for Android users—and also help us rename the app and update the developer name on both iOS and Android platforms.

Role Overview
We’re looking for an experienced submission specialist who can:
• Manage the approval process of our Android app on the Google Play Store, ensuring full compliance with their policies.
• Oversee the renaming of the app and the developer’s name for both iOS and Android stores, coordinating with developers and platform requirements.
• Provide guidance and handle the submission process on both Google Play and iOS App Store platforms.

Key Responsibilities
• Review the existing Android app build for Google Play compliance and liaise with the developer to address any technical or policy issues.
• Manage the renaming process of the app and developer name on both iOS and Android platforms, ensuring smooth implementation and compliance.
• Prepare and configure the Google Play Console listing and App Store Connect listing, including app descriptions, categorisation, screenshots, and metadata.
• Upload and submit the app(s) for review on both platforms, troubleshoot any issues flagged by Google or Apple during the approval process.
• Provide regular updates on progress and best practice advice to ensure compliance and successful launches.
• Offer guidance on post-launch updates, maintenance, and store optimisation.

Requirements
• Proven experience successfully submitting and getting apps approved on Google Play and the iOS App Store.
• Strong knowledge of Google Play and Apple App Store policies and guidelines (content, privacy, technical requirements).
• Experience managing app signing, release management, and developer account settings on both platforms.
• Ability to troubleshoot rejection reasons and resolve issues promptly.
• Excellent communication skills and ability to work independently and liaise with developers.

Desirable
• Experience working with small businesses or community-focused organisations.
• Familiarity with renaming apps and updating developer names on both platforms.
